Armenian Bishop Unable to Calm Down Mothers of Dead Soldiers (VIDEO)

Four years ago today, on January 27, behind the bars of the Presidential Palace, the mothers of dead soldiers spoke to President Serzh Sargsyan who promised that their children’s cases would be investigated fairly and those guilty would be punished. This promise was never fulfilled and today, those same mothers raised the issue of the President’s promise in front of the palace, while holding the photo they had of their conversation with the president. Another copy of the photograph was thrown to the ground by the mothers. One of the police officers asked them to stop stepping on the photo of the president. “But you’re also in the photo,” said one of the police officers, however, that did not convince the protesters who kept stepping on the photo, after which the officer came, picked up the photo and left.

The Presidential staff, once again, did not meet with the protesters. A meeting was taking place with the state commission for organizing events for the 100th anniversary of the Armenian Genocide.

After the meeting at Presidential Palace, Bishop Bagrat Galstanyan exited the building and approached the mothers in order to listen to their issues. The protesters spoke to the clergymen with “Who are you praying for? The bastard president?”

Bishop Bagrat asked the mothers to calm down. Gohar Sargsyan, the mother of soldier Tigran Ohanjanyan, responded saying that they would not calm down until their sons' case’s are dealt with in a just manner.

“Problems are not solved like this, isn’t there another way? A legal avenue, court, trial,” advised Bishop Bagrat.

“We have tried every avenue. There are no fair trials. If the chief commander commands, the issue will be solved, if not, then no,” said Gohar Sargsyan.

The mothers also complained that the church is not on their side either.
